Transaction 78c26707b6766a98fc1d12e6ce69b750520a02a84e3d45125250ff8582b16a61
2 Input
2 Outputs
- 78c26707b6766a98fc1d12e6ce69b750520a02a84e3d45125250ff8582b16a61:0
- 78c26707b6766a98fc1d12e6ce69b750520a02a84e3d45125250ff8582b16a61:1
value 33866488
address 3LyEC3nDLXKpq56eY8tAxYv4SETsPjbC5Q
value 355881595
address 1ApyEGcGGSEktcYjKvUsohRqx9ALoxwVAD